Russians attacked Odesa region with missiles and drones, targeting infrastructure

On the night of April 19, the Russian army attacked Odesa region. The occupiers used missiles and attack drones. This was reported by the head of the Odesa RMA, Oleh Kiper, on Telegram.

 

 

"Russian troops targeted critical infrastructure of the region. Fortunately, people were not injured," the statement said.

 

The head of Odesa RMA did not specify the consequences of the attack. But Kiper added that law enforcement officers are recording the consequences of another Russian crime.

 

In addition, according to the Air Force of the Ukrainian Armed Forces, Russia launched 22 missiles of various types and 14 kamikaze drones at Ukraine at night. The air defense forces shot down all the Shaheds and 15 missiles.
